**Mgmt Meeting Minutes — Retiring the Brightline Range**

Quick recap for sales leads at Fenholt Supplies: we agreed to retire the Brightline fixture range by year-end. Remaining stock moves to clearance pricing next month, and accounts on standing orders get migrated to the Lumetta range. Trade-in incentives were approved in principle. The confidential note on next steps sits just below.

board note of bajof-bajeg: The pricing group signed off on a budget of $13.4 million for Project Sildor. The renewal with Lamixek Holdings closes at $48.9 million a year, 49 percent above the last contract.

Handover: the Fennick metrics sidecar. It scrapes app pods every 15s, pre-aggregates counters, and ships rollups to the Tallyhouse backend. If rollups stall, check the sidecar's buffer gauge first — backpressure usually means the backend ingest queue is full, not a sidecar bug. Restarts are safe; buffers flush on shutdown. Config reference and common alerts are on the page below.

runbook for badug-kadup: https://confluence.zemvarlabs.internal/projects/browse/display/projects/bd1b

## 4.9.0 — Key rotation

The signing key for Lattice UI, our shared component library, was rotated as part of the scheduled annual cycle. All packages from 4.9.0 onward are signed with the new key; older versions remain verifiable with the archived one. New team members should update their local verification config to trust the key below.

rollout seal: bky4_DFM9